About the Role
Delivering services under the government’s new ParentsNext contract, APM’s Parent & Family Pathway Planners have an opportunity to provide advocacy, coaching and mentoring to Parents who have made the decision to prepare for their return to work or study.

For more than 25 years, we’ve been enabling better lives through employment, allied health intervention, community care and workplace health services. Each year, our services reach more than one million people across ten countries.
